One-Pan Lemon Garlic Shrimp & Rice

One-Pan Lemon Garlic Shrimp & Rice

This one-pan lemon garlic shrimp and rice is a weeknight dinner hero—quick, vibrant, and packed with flavor. Plump shrimp, fluffy rice, and a burst of lemon come together in under 30 minutes, all in a single skillet. Perfect for busy nights or when you want something special without the fuss.

Ingredients

  • 1 lb large shrimp, peeled and deveined
  • 1 cup long-grain white rice
  • 2 cups chicken broth
  • 2 tbsp olive oil
  • 3 cloves garlic, minced
  • 1 lemon (zest and juice)
  • 1/2 tsp paprika
  • 1/2 tsp salt
  • 1/4 tsp black pepper
  • 1/4 tsp crushed red pepper flakes (optional)
  • 1 cup frozen peas
  • 2 tbsp fresh parsley, chopped (plus more for garnish)
  • Lemon wedges, for serving

Instructions

  1. Heat 1 tablespoon olive oil in a large skillet over medium heat. Add shrimp, season with salt, pepper, and paprika. Cook for 1-2 minutes per side until just pink. Remove shrimp and set aside.
  2. In the same skillet, add remaining olive oil and garlic. Sauté for 30 seconds until fragrant.
  3. Add rice and stir to coat in the oil and garlic. Toast for 1 minute.
  4. Pour in chicken broth, lemon zest, and lemon juice. Stir, bring to a boil, then reduce heat to low. Cover and simmer for 15 minutes.
  5. After 15 minutes, stir in frozen peas. Place shrimp on top of the rice, cover, and cook for another 5 minutes until rice is tender and shrimp are heated through.
  6. Remove from heat. Sprinkle with fresh parsley and extra lemon juice if desired.
  7. Serve hot, garnished with more parsley and lemon wedges.

Tips

  • Swap in brown rice for a whole-grain twist—just increase the cooking time and broth.
  • Try adding chopped spinach or bell peppers for extra veggies.

FAQ

Can I use frozen shrimp?
Yes, just thaw and pat dry before cooking.

What if I don’t have chicken broth?
Water with a bouillon cube or vegetable broth works too.

How do I store leftovers?
Keep in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 2 days. Reheat gently to avoid overcooking the shrimp.
